GERRIT GORTER
The present study of economics did not, of course, come out of thin air. Although thinkers in classical Greece already reflected on what we now call economics, it was largely in the eighteenth century that systematic thought on the subject began.
Two conceptual tools—the economic cycle and the idea of the invisible hand—date from that century and are still in use today, both in academic research and in education.
This site contains twenty-five portraits of important economists. Each offers a biographical sketch together with an indication of his (and, in one case, her) significance for the development of economic thought. They claim no more than to provide a first introduction to the lives and works of these pioneers.
These articles originally appeared in Dutch in the Tijdschrift voor het Economisch Onderwijs and were published on the website of Gerrit Gorter. The English translations are by Folkert Gorter.

Irving Fisher
U.S.A. 1867–1947
His entire life, the American economist Irving Fisher was preoccupied with money — first with acquiring it, then with losing it, and finally with trying to win it back. But no one would have heard of Fisher if he hadn’t also been a major theorist in the field of monetary economics. Every monetary economist up to and including Milton Friedman is indebted to him.
Irving Fisher was born in 1867 in upstate New York. He studied at Yale College and developed a strong preference for mathematics. His later economic writings, accordingly, contain a substantial dose of mathematics — especially for that time. After earning his doctorate, he remained at Yale as a professor. He soon devoted himself to what would become his true area of expertise: the interrelationships between the money supply, the velocity of money, and prices. Around the age of thirty, he seemed to have it all: a professorship, a reputation for brilliance, a happy marriage, and good health.
The news that he had tuberculosis therefore came as a heavy blow. This disease was virtually a death sentence at the time, but Fisher was determined to survive. Miraculously, he did — and for the rest of his life, he remained a health nut: regular jogging, lots of fruit, no alcohol, no tobacco, and a constant craving for fresh air. Even the all-too-common side effect — a certain humorlessness — showed in Fisher.
Another defining factor in Fisher’s life was money — and not just in the theoretical sense. At the age of 43, he developed a particular card-based filing system for administrative use — the so-called Rolodex — which made him a wealthy man. Thanks to some fortunate investments, he soon became a multimillionaire. But then came the stock market crash of 1929, in which he lost most of his fortune. He was firmly convinced, however, that the market would rebound, and borrowed large sums from various sources — only to lose them just as quickly. Fisher spent the rest of his life burdened by debts he could never repay.
His principal contribution to economics was the quantity theory of money. In 1911, he published The Purchasing Power of Money, in which he examined the factors that determine the purchasing power of money — or, conversely, the price level. Of course, the relationship between the money supply and inflation had long been known — since the sixteenth century, in fact — and the concept of the “velocity” of money had also been discovered. But Fisher was the first to systematize these elements in what has become the well-known equation of exchange: MV = PQ, where M stands for the money supply, V for the velocity of money, P for the general price level, and Q for the quantity of goods traded. Seen this way, the quantity theory is little more than an identity: of course, the active flow of money equals total transactions. But if V and Q are assumed to remain relatively constant in the short term, then it becomes clear that an increase in the money supply leads to inflation.
But the quantity theory was not Fisher’s only contribution to economics. He also worked on index number theory. Anyone who has ever taken a statistics exam may recall the index number named after our economist. The distinction between flow and stock variables also originates with him. According to his own account, he came up with this distinction during a hike in the Swiss Alps, when he saw a waterfall (a flow variable) plunging into a lake (a stock variable). He also clearly articulated the difference between nominal and real interest (the latter being roughly the nominal interest rate minus inflation).
The final ten years of Fisher’s life were certainly not his best: burdened by heavy debts (he owed his sister-in-law $750,000), his house sold at auction, the loss of his wife (1940), many futile attempts to rebuild his fortune (returning to inventing, he came up with a collapsible chair that nobody wanted), and finally, cancer struck. Since death visits even the most devoted health enthusiasts, he lost the battle and died in 1947. He is widely regarded as the most important American economist of the first half of the twentieth century.
